Configure the UDDI registry to use UDDI security

 

The UDDI V3 registry can be configured to enable UDDI security when there is a strong preference for UDDI security, compared to WebSphere Application Server security.

 

Overview

You can use the UDDI registry security features when WebSphere Application Server security is either enabled or disabled. For example, you can use UDDI security with WebSphere Application Server security disabled for test purposes. Each situation requires different configuration, and results in different behavior.

Note: Do not disable WebSphere Application Server security for production configurations. To continue configuring the UDDI registry to use UDDI security, choose one of the following options:
